Subject: Autocomplete index slowness — status

Quick summary for the sync: the Quillseek autocomplete index has been rebuilding slowly since Tuesday. Root cause is the new prefix-trie compaction competing with the nightly vocabulary refresh on the same worker pool. Mitigation shipped: compaction now yields during refresh windows. p95 suggestion latency back under 60ms on the Dray cluster. Full fix (separate pool) lands next sprint. No user-facing errors, just lag. Flagging the affected build below so folks can pin their repros.

build token for kagaf-hahof: htk14_9d3d4d26d7d8de

# Provenance Note: Image Cache Leak Fix

Support: the memory leak in the Pondview image cache affected versions 4.2 through 4.4. Thumbnails were retained after eviction due to a listener that was never detached. Customers on those versions should upgrade; no data was affected. The patched release traces to the build listed below.

pipeline stamp: htk9_ce63042d9

This page summarises the Brightvale Partner Network for the incoming director.

The programme covers 42 resellers across three tiers, with margins of 12–22% depending on volume commitments. Tier reviews happen twice yearly; Dorrin Vask currently administers certification and co-marketing funds. Renewal season runs February to April.

Key issues: two Tier 1 partners in the Keldmere region are underperforming, and the rebate structure needs simplification. The following note explains where the programme is heading next.

board note of tawip-hahip: Only 7 of the 80 pilot accounts renewed Ralath, so a churn review is set for April 1.

## Alert: StatRelay Sidecar Flush Lag

This alert fires when the StatRelay metrics-aggregation sidecar falls more than 120 seconds behind on flushing buffered samples to the Coalmine backend. Plugin-emitted counters are buffered in-process, so sustained lag usually means a plugin is emitting unbounded label cardinality or blocking the flush thread. Check your plugin's metric registration against the published cardinality limits before escalating. If the lag persists after your plugin is ruled out, contact the telemetry team.

escalation mailbox, bagug-fahof: novdor.wendor.jormir@norvalabs.example